Jessamine County Magistrates
DISTRICT 2

Tim Vaughan

Tim Vaughan is a resident of Jessamine County for over 13 years and is currently a bank loan officer. Tim is a graduate of Asbury College with a degree in Philosphy and Economics.

Tim assists in overseeing matters before the Court involving the Jessamine Detention Center, Dog Park Committee and County E-911 Committee.He is also actve in the community as Co-Chairman of Leadership Jessamine County, member of the High Bridge Park & Festival Committee, Camp Nelson Steering Committee, Wilmore Community Development Board and a graduate of Nicholasville Citizens Police Academy as well as an active member of Church of the Savior on Brannon Road.

Magistrate Vaughan seen in front of the new Guard Rail on Lock 7 Road in High Bridge. Also with him are High Bridge resident Margaret Morgan and County Road Supervisor Coleman Tudor.

Recent accomplishments on the Court include his sponsorship of the successfully passed Jessamine County Noise Control Ordinance seeking to protect citizens from excessive nighttime animal noise. Tim secured a $30,000 state Transportation grant for the recently constructed guard rail on Lock 7 Road in High Bridge. The guard rail will protect motorists and school buses on this narrow road which lays several hundred feet above the KY River.

He has also secured funds for a county fire station station on Ichthus Campgrounds (US 68) of which the expected completion is for the end of 2006. The fire station will service southwest Jessamine County.
